Fallon, Nevada - Detoxification
A primary reason drug addicted men and women in Fallon, NV. find it difficult to cease using drugs and alcohol soon after they start using them, is because of physical and psychological reliance that inevitably evolves if the person uses them for a certain length of time which can vary. So when someone ceases the use of drugs they will begin to notice symptoms as their bodies detox from drugs known as drug withdrawal. To make detoxification a more safe process, it is important that drug and alcohol addicted individuals in Fallon, NV. who wish to quit do so in an appropriate setting such as an alcohol and drug rehab center. Drug rehabilitation centers in Fallon, NV. will help persons easily through the detox process and also work to relieve and ease withdrawal symptoms, while also making sure the person doesn't fall back into drug and alcohol abuse. After detox and withdrawal is effectively overcome, treatment professionals in Fallon, NV. will get clients started on an extensive drug and alcohol treatment program to make sure they don't relapse in the future.
